Railways.
GREAT SOUTHERN & WESTERN RAILWAY.
INTERNATIONAL AUTOMOBILE RACE.
(GORDON-BENNETT CUP),
THURSDAY, 2ND JULY, 1903ON WEDNESDAY, 1ST JULY,
A Special Passenger Train will leave, Kingsbridge
FOR CURRAGH MAIN LINE PLATFORM, KILDARE AND ATHY.
At 5.45 p.m., by which Excursion Tickets at the following fares
will be available:-

Tickets available for return on 2nd or 3rd July,
ON THURSDAY, 2ND JULY,
Special Passenger Trains will leave Kingsbridge for CURRAGH
MAIN LINE PLATFORM, KILDARE AND ATHY,
From 3 a.m. continuously as filled, returning from Athy
from about 4 p.m.

Tickets available for return on date of issue only.
Tickets at the above fares will be on sale at the Booking Office,
Kingsbridge Station, and at the Offices of Messrs. T. Cook and
Son, 117, Grafton Street, and Messrs. Wallis and Sons, 33, Bachelor's
Walk, Dublin, from 16th June, but the issue will be stopped,
several days prior to the day of the race.
C.H. DENT, General Manager.
